Home Care Versus Nursing Home
One of the most difficult decisions that you will have to take at one point or the other in your life is whether to send your loved elderly relative to a nursing home or not. In the last decade, home care services have made their presence felt in the nursing sector. This means that you have an alternative to nursing homes.
Here are some things you should be aware of when it comes to choosing medical care for a loved elderly relative:
· Health care requirements: If your elderly loved one does not have a debilitating health issue and needs assistance due to aging, home care packages in Tweed Heads will be a good choice for them. A lot of people who use a home care agency have some degree of mobility problems that make everyday tasks a bit difficult to do. Even if your relative has advanced mobility issues, a home care agency is the best bet. You only need to consider a nursing home in case your elderly loved one has a serious medical condition.
· Care Quality: With home care in Tweeds Heads, the care offered will be at a very personal level and your relative will know their nurses and orderlies on a first name basis. The care plan will be based on individual needs, including food choices, preferences, hobbies, and more. On the other hand, care given at the nursing home is impersonal in nature and your relative might have cause for complaint.
· Care cost: Nursing home care is definitely more costly than home care services in Tweed Heads. Home care is the better option because in most cases, the person in question may not need full care. They may only need help to move about, so you should consider aged care services in Tweed rather than a nursing home.
· Quality of life: Quality of life is perhaps the most important concern. With nursing homes, the patient will not be at home, will be confined to the bed, will be excluded from the community, and be away from the family. However, with home care packages, the recipient of the care will have a much better quality of life.
The above points show that home care is much better than care at a nursing home. If there are no serious medical problems, home care should be chosen over a nursing home.
